The STM32F103C8T6 Blue Pill Development Board is a compact and powerful ARM Cortex-M3 microcontroller board designed for advanced embedded system development. Built around the STM32F103C8T6 MCU, this board operates at 72 MHz and provides high performance with low power consumption.

The Blue Pill board is widely used in robotics, automation, IoT systems, motor control, and real-time embedded applications. It supports multiple communication interfaces including USART, I2C, SPI, CAN, and USB, making it highly versatile for professional and educational projects.

With 64KB Flash memory and 20KB SRAM, this development board offers sufficient resources for complex firmware applications. It can be programmed using ST-Link V2 or compatible USB-to-Serial adapters and supports STM32CubeIDE and Arduino IDE (STM32 core).

Technical Specifications:

• MCU: STM32F103C8T6

• Core: ARM Cortex-M3

• Clock Speed: 72 MHz

• Flash Memory: 64 KB

• SRAM: 20 KB

• Operating Voltage: 3.3V

• Digital I/O Pins: 37

• Communication Interfaces: USART, SPI, I2C, CAN, USB

• Micro USB / External Programming Support
